Categories: Guides & Tutorials

Unveiling the Secrets of Brackets Coding Software

Unveiling the Secrets of Brackets Coding Software

Brackets is an open-source, modern text editor that’s tailored specifically for web developers and designers. It combines the ease of use of a simple code editor with powerful features, making it a popular choice for anyone working with HTML, CSS, and JavaScript. As more developers search for the best tools to streamline their coding processes, Brackets continues to rise as a go-to platform due to its range of functionalities and user-friendly design. This article delves into the features, installation, and some troubleshooting tips of Brackets to help you make the most of this powerful coding software.

What is Brackets?

Brackets is a free, open-source code editor built by Adobe, designed specifically for web development. It is lightweight, fast, and offers a suite of built-in tools that make the process of writing code easier and more intuitive. With features such as live preview, inline editing, and preprocessor support, Brackets provides a seamless development experience that saves both time and effort.

The software was initially released in 2014, and since then, it has gained popularity among web developers and front-end designers. Its sleek user interface and extensive customization options make it stand out from other text editors, such as Sublime Text or Visual Studio Code.

Key Features of Brackets

  • Live Preview: See your changes instantly in a browser window as you make edits to your code. This eliminates the need to refresh your browser every time you make a change.
  • Inline Editing: With Brackets, you can open and edit CSS styles directly within your HTML files, making it easier to tweak designs and layout without switching contexts.
  • Preprocessor Support: Brackets supports preprocessor languages such as Sass and Less, allowing you to use variables, mixins, and functions in your CSS code.
  • Extensions: A wide range of extensions is available to enhance Brackets’ functionality. These include integrations with Git, code linters, and even support for additional programming languages.
  • Split View: Brackets allows you to view and edit multiple files side by side, making it easier to work on complex projects that involve many different files.

How to Install Brackets on Your System

Installing Brackets is straightforward and can be done in just a few steps. Whether you are using Windows, Mac, or Linux, the installation process is the same.

Step-by-Step Installation Guide

  1. Download Brackets: Visit the official website of Brackets at brackets.io to download the latest version of the software. Make sure to download the version that corresponds to your operating system (Windows, macOS, or Linux).
  2. Run the Installer: After downloading the installer file, double-click it to start the installation process. For Windows, it will be an .exe file, and for macOS, it will be a .dmg file.
  3. Follow the On-Screen Instructions: Follow the instructions provided by the installation wizard. This usually involves agreeing to the terms of service and choosing the installation directory.
  4. Launch Brackets: Once the installation is complete, launch Brackets. You can now start coding with the editor.

Setting Up Your First Project in Brackets

After installing Brackets, you can begin using it right away. Here’s a quick guide on how to set up your first project:

  1. Create a New Folder: Create a folder on your system where you will store all the files related to your project.
  2. Open the Folder in Brackets: Open Brackets and select File > Open Folder. Browse to the folder you created and open it.
  3. Create New Files: Inside Brackets, click File > New to create new HTML, CSS, and JavaScript files for your project. Make sure to save them with the correct file extensions (.html, .css, .js).
  4. Write and Preview Your Code: Start coding in your new files. Use the live preview feature to see your work in real time.

Common Troubleshooting Tips for Brackets Users

While Brackets is a reliable text editor, like any software, it may encounter some issues. Below are some common problems users face and how to troubleshoot them:

1. Live Preview Not Working

If the live preview feature isn’t working, it may be due to an issue with your browser settings or a conflict with an extension. Here’s how to resolve it:

  • Ensure that your browser is properly connected to Brackets. Open the live preview and check if it launches the correct browser window.
  • Disable or remove any extensions that might interfere with the live preview function. You can check for conflicts by opening Brackets in a fresh workspace with no extensions enabled.
  • Make sure the file you’re working on is saved before trying to preview it. Brackets requires saved files to display changes in live preview.

2. Slow Performance or Freezing

If Brackets is running slow or freezes frequently, try the following solutions:

  • Close unnecessary tabs or files in Brackets to reduce memory usage.
  • Check for updates and install the latest version of Brackets, as newer versions may have performance improvements.
  • Consider disabling some extensions that you do not use often, as they can slow down the editor.

3. Extensions Not Installing

If you’re unable to install extensions in Brackets, follow these troubleshooting steps:

  • Ensure that your internet connection is stable, as Brackets needs an active internet connection to download extensions.
  • Try installing extensions manually by downloading them from the official Brackets extension registry and dragging them into the extensions folder of your Brackets installation directory.
  • If the extension manager is malfunctioning, restart Brackets and try again.

Brackets vs Other Code Editors: Why Choose Brackets?

With so many code editors available, you may wonder why Brackets stands out. Here’s a quick comparison between Brackets and other popular code editors:

  • Brackets vs Sublime Text: While Sublime Text is known for its speed, Brackets offers more web development-specific features such as live preview and inline editing.
  • Brackets vs Visual Studio Code: Visual Studio Code is a powerhouse with a wide range of extensions, but Brackets focuses more on a lightweight, streamlined experience for web developers.
  • Brackets vs Atom: Atom, developed by GitHub, is highly customizable like Brackets, but Brackets focuses more on the design aspects, making it more suitable for designers working with HTML and CSS.

Ultimately, Brackets is the perfect choice for developers who need a fast, intuitive editor with robust web development features like live preview and preprocessor support.

Conclusion

Brackets is an excellent choice for web developers looking for a lightweight, feature-rich code editor. With its user-friendly interface, live preview, inline editing, and support for preprocessors, it provides everything you need to streamline your coding process. By following the installation steps and troubleshooting tips provided in this guide, you can get up and running with Brackets in no time. Whether you are working on a small project or a complex website, Brackets is the perfect tool to help you bring your ideas to life.

For more tips and tricks on coding with Brackets, visit our resource center to dive deeper into the world of web development tools. Don’t forget to check the official Brackets website for the latest updates and community extensions.

This article is in the category Guides & Tutorials and created by CodingTips Team

webadmin

Recent Posts

Unveiling the Secrets of High-Performance Coding

Discover the hidden strategies and techniques for high-performance coding in this insightful article.

2 hours ago

Unlocking the Future: UTSA’s Coding Camps for Kids

Discover how UTSA is shaping the next generation of tech-savvy kids with its innovative coding…

4 hours ago

Unveiling the Truth: Do Older IE’s Still Require HTML5 Coding?

Explore the necessity of HTML5 coding for older versions of Internet Explorer and its impact…

5 hours ago

Uncovering the Impact of Comments on Coding Efficiency

Explore the role of comments in coding efficiency and discover best practices for software development.

5 hours ago

Unveiling the Truth: Hidden Costs of Using WhatsApp on Android

Discover the real price of using WhatsApp on Android. Uncover hidden costs and implications for…

6 hours ago

Unleashing the Power of Coding for Student Success

Discover the transformative benefits of coding for students and how it can shape their future.

19 hours ago